刘政道 - 应用程序框架

《31天学会CRM项目开发(C#编程入门及项目实战)》作者,IT经理,程序员
  博客园  :: 新随笔  :: 联系 :: 管理

Richfaces优化,Richfaces为何这么慢?

Posted on 2010-01-18 10:52  刘政道  阅读(550)  评论(0编辑  收藏  举报

参见:http://www.ceapet.com/topic40.html

使用Richfaces有一段时间,发现,Richfaces比较慢,简单的一个页面也需要很长时间,有点让人望而生畏。

找了一些优化的文章,研究了研究,似乎有点效果。不管拥有无用,还是照做。
当 然,也发现,用Firefox至少比IE或IE内核之类的浏览器快上N倍,不信,你试试。

在web.xml中要进行如下配置

代码
     <filter>
       
<display-name>Ajax4jsf Filter</display-name>
       
<filter-name>ajax4jsf</filter-name>
       
<filter-class>org.ajax4jsf.Filter</filter-class>
       
<init-param>
          
<param-name>forceparser</param-name>
          
<param-value>false</param-value>
       
</init-param>
       
<init-param>
          
<param-name>enable-cache</param-name>
          
<param-value>true</param-value> </init-param>
       
<init-param>
          
<param-name>createTempFiles</param-name>
          
<param-value>true</param-value>
       
</init-param>
       
<init-param>
          
<param-name>maxRequestSize</param-name>
          
<param-value>1024000000</param-value>
       
</init-param>
    
</filter>


增加forceparser 和enable-cache配置项...